Virtuoso is a QA automation testing tool that leverages Natural Language Programming (NLP), Artificial Intelligence (AI), and Machine Learning (ML) to streamline the testing process. It combines NLP and Robotic Process Automation (RPA) into a single platform, offering self-healing and scalable test automation.
Key Features:
- Natural Language Programming: Allows users to write tests in plain English, making test authoring accessible to a wider range of team members.
- AI-Powered Self-Healing: Automatically adapts tests to changes in the application, reducing test maintenance efforts.
- Robotic Process Automation: Automates repetitive tasks, improving efficiency and reducing manual effort.
- Scalability: Designed to handle the testing needs of enterprise software, ensuring comprehensive test coverage.
- Integrations: Seamlessly integrates with existing development and testing tools.
- Test Reporting: Provides detailed insights into testing results, including AI-generated theories on test failures.
Use Cases:
- Functional UI Testing: Ensures the functionality of user interfaces across different browsers and devices.
- End-to-End Testing: Validates the entire application workflow, from start to finish.
- Regression Testing: Identifies defects introduced by new code changes.
- Continuous Testing: Integrates testing into the CI/CD pipeline for faster feedback and continuous improvement.
- Business Process Orchestration: Organize, sequence, and validate business workflows.